Product Description:
The BTA20.3-NA-WA-VA-BS is a machine control board from Bosch Rexroth Indramat that belongs to the BTA20 Machine Control Boards series. Designed for installation in distributed automation racks, the board coordinates I/O data exchange and local override logic inside a motion or process cell. By combining fieldbus connectivity with on-board 24 V signal handling, it links sensors, actuators, and safety devices to the higher-level PLC in an industrial automation network.
Field communication is managed through the INTERBUS-S / BT-BUS interface, allowing deterministic telegram transfer between the controller and remote nodes. The board streams cyclic process data in an I/O width of 3 words, equal to 48 bits per scan. Eight external 24 V inputs accept dry-contact or transistor signals, while a bank of 8 external 24 V outputs sources device power. Each output line can deliver up to 200 mA before electronic current limiting engages. Remote diagnostics remain responsive because telegrams move at 500 kbaud on the remote bus segment. These values indicate the throughput and loading limits that must be observed when sizing sensor loops, valve coils, or light stacks driven directly from the card.
Local operator interaction and safety interlock are handled separately from the cyclic bus data. A pair of emergency-stop contacts in a 2 N/C arrangement is routed to the safety relay chain so the board can drop power instantly on demand. Manual speed reduction uses a selector that encodes its setting as 4-bit Gray code across 16 lock positions, allowing predictable single-bit transitions during runtime overrides. The aluminum front panel is laminated with polyester foil and sealed to achieve IP65 protection when mounted. The remaining electronics sit inside a chassis rated at IP20 once inside the cabinet. This layout keeps the operator-facing surface protected while the internal electronics remain suited for cabinet installation.
Frequently Asked Questions about BTA20.3-NA-WA-VA-BS:
Q: What communication buses are supported by the BTA20.3-NA-WA-VA-BS control board?
A: The BTA20.3-NA-WA-VA-BS supports INTERBUS-S and BT-BUS for communication.
Q: How many external 24 V inputs are available on the BTA20.3-NA-WA-VA-BS?
A: This model has 8 external 24 V inputs for signal interfacing.
Q: What is the maximum per-output current on the BTA20.3-NA-WA-VA-BS board?
A: Each output can handle a current of up to 200 mA on the BTA20.3-NA-WA-VA-BS.
Q: What level of front panel protection does the BTA20.3-NA-WA-VA-BS provide?
A: The front panel offers IP65 protection, ensuring strong resistance against dust and water ingress.
Q: How many override lock positions does the BTA20.3-NA-WA-VA-BS feature?
A: There are 16 lock positions available for override encoding on this model.
